remains one of the most eccentric and beloved life simulation games on the Nintendo 3DS. Released globally in 2014, this quirky title allows players to populate an island with Mii characters, watch them interact, fall in love, and engage in bizarre daily activities.
Here's a detailed breakdown of the information:
You populate an entire island with Miis—the avatar system created for the Nintendo Wii. Once these Miis move in, they develop their own personalities, interact with each other, fall in love, get married, and experience all the drama of daily life.
